Common Mistakes to Avoid When Hiring Movers

Date:

Hiring professional movers is a smart decision when it comes to making your move smooth and hassle-free. However, there are certain common mistakes that people often make when hiring movers, which can lead to unnecessary stress, delays, or even financial loss. In this article, we will discuss some of the common mistakes to avoid when hiring movers, ensuring a successful and stress-free moving experience.

  1. Not Researching and Comparing Multiple Companies

One of the biggest mistakes is not investing enough time in researching and demenageur multiple moving companies. Take the time to research different companies in your area, read reviews, and compare their services, pricing, and customer feedback. Don’t settle for the first company you come across; instead, gather multiple quotes and evaluate each company’s reputation and track record before making a decision.

  1. Not Checking Credentials and Licensing

Another crucial mistake is failing to check the credentials and licensing of the moving company. Ensure that the company is properly licensed and registered with the appropriate authorities. Request their license number and verify it with the relevant regulatory agency. Checking credentials gives you confidence in the legitimacy and professionalism of the company you are considering.

  1. Not Getting a Written Estimate

Verbal estimates or rough calculations are not sufficient when it comes to hiring movers. Always request a written estimate from the moving company that clearly outlines the costs, including any additional fees or charges. This written estimate ensures transparency and helps you avoid any surprises when it comes to the final bill.

  1. Not Asking About Insurance Coverage

Failure to inquire about insurance coverage is a common mistake that can lead to significant financial loss in the event of damage or loss of your belongings. Ask the moving company about their insurance coverage and understand the extent of protection it provides. Additionally, consider purchasing additional insurance if you have valuable or irreplaceable items.

  1. Not Disclosing Important Details

It is essential to disclose all relevant details to the moving company before finalizing the agreement. This includes informing them about any special requirements, such as fragile or valuable items, items that require disassembly or special handling, or any obstacles at either the pickup or delivery location. Providing accurate and detailed information ensures that the movers come prepared and can plan accordingly.

  1. Not Getting a Written Contract

Verbal agreements are risky and can lead to misunderstandings or disputes later on. Always insist on a written contract that clearly outlines the terms and conditions of the move, including the agreed-upon services, pricing, payment terms, and any additional arrangements. Review the contract carefully and make sure you understand and agree to all the terms before signing it.

  1. Not Checking for Hidden Costs or Additional Fees

Some moving companies may add hidden costs or additional fees that are not initially disclosed. It is essential to inquire about any potential additional charges, such as fees for stairs, elevators, long carries, or bulky items. Get a comprehensive understanding of the pricing structure and ensure that there are no surprises when it comes to the final invoice.

  1. Not Asking for References or Reading Reviews

A reliable moving company will have no hesitation in providing references from satisfied customers or allowing you to read their reviews. Not checking references or reading reviews is a mistake that can lead to hiring an inexperienced or unprofessional mover. Take the time to contact references and ask about their experience with the company. Additionally, read online reviews to gain insights into the reputation and reliability of the movers you are considering.

  1. Not Planning Ahead and Booking in Advance

Last-minute bookings can lead to limited availability or higher costs. It is recommended to plan ahead and book your movers well in advance, especially during peak moving seasons. Booking early ensures that you secure the services of a reputable mover at a competitive price, giving you peace of mind and allowing for proper planning of other moving-related tasks.

  1. Not Asking Questions or Seeking Clarification

Do not hesitate to ask questions or seek clarification from the moving company. Clear communication is essential for a successful move. Ask about their experience, equipment, packing procedures, and any concerns or doubts you may have. A professional moving company will be happy to address your queries and provide the necessary information. Avoiding these common mistakes when hiring movers can save you time, money, and stress. By conducting thorough research, asking the right questions, and being proactive in your approach, you can ensure a smooth and successful moving experience.
